Step 3: Backup the defaults Rename the existing ddnet.png and ddnet_entities.png in your data/ folder to ddnet_old.png and ddnet_entities_old.png. Never delete them.

Step 4: Copy the new files Drag the new ddnet.png and ddnet_entities.png into the data/ folder. Overwrite if prompted. Many users give up because they drag files

Step 5: Force reload in game Launch DDNet. Go to Settings -> Graphics -> Reset Textures. If that doesn’t work, type reset textures in the console (F1).

Important: The game does not auto-update texture packs. A pack made for Teeworlds 0.6.x may still work in DDNet (latest: 18.x), but missing new entities (e.g., teleport tiles, gores tiles) will show as pink/black checkers.
